/* AVX/AVX2 ISA version as wrapper to SSE ISA version. */
.macro WRAPPER_IMPL_AVX callee
pushq %rbp
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set (8)
cfi_rel_offset (%rbp, 0)
movq %rsp, %rbp
cfi_def_cfa_register (%rbp)
andq $-32, %rsp
subq $32, %rsp
vmovaps %ymm0, (%rsp)
vzeroupper
call HIDDEN_JUMPTARGET(\callee)
vmovaps %xmm0, (%rsp)
vmovaps 16(%rsp), %xmm0
call HIDDEN_JUMPTARGET(\callee)
/* combine xmm0 (return of second call) with result of first
call (saved on stack). Might be worth exploring logic that
uses `vpblend` and reads in ymm1 using -16(rsp). */
vmovaps (%rsp), %xmm1
vinsertf128 $1, %xmm0, %ymm1, %ymm0
movq %rbp, %rsp
cfi_def_cfa_register (%rsp)
popq %rbp
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set (-8)
cfi_restore (%rbp)
ret
.endm
/* 2 argument AVX/AVX2 ISA version as wrapper to SSE ISA version. */
.macro WRAPPER_IMPL_AVX_ff callee
pushq %rbp
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set (8)
cfi_rel_offset (%rbp, 0)
movq %rsp, %rbp
cfi_def_cfa_register (%rbp)
andq $-32, %rsp
subq $64, %rsp
vmovaps %ymm0, (%rsp)
vmovaps %ymm1, 32(%rsp)
vzeroupper
call HIDDEN_JUMPTARGET(\callee)
vmovaps 48(%rsp), %xmm1
vmovaps %xmm0, (%rsp)
vmovaps 16(%rsp), %xmm0
call HIDDEN_JUMPTARGET(\callee)
/* combine xmm0 (return of second call) with result of first
call (saved on stack). Might be worth exploring logic that
uses `vpblend` and reads in ymm1 using -16(rsp). */
vmovaps (%rsp), %xmm1
vinsertf128 $1, %xmm0, %ymm1, %ymm0
movq %rbp, %rsp
cfi_def_cfa_register (%rsp)
popq %rbp
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set (-8)
cfi_restore (%rbp)
ret
.endm
/* 3 argument AVX/AVX2 ISA version as wrapper to SSE ISA version. */
.macro WRAPPER_IMPL_AVX_fFF callee
pushq %rbp
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set (8)
cfi_rel_offset (%rbp, 0)
movq %rsp, %rbp
andq $-32, %rsp
subq $32, %rsp
vmovaps %ymm0, (%rsp)
pushq %rbx
pushq %r14
movq %rdi, %rbx
movq %rsi, %r14
vzeroupper
call HIDDEN_JUMPTARGET(\callee)
vmovaps 32(%rsp), %xmm0
leaq 16(%rbx), %rdi
leaq 16(%r14), %rsi
call HIDDEN_JUMPTARGET(\callee)
popq %r14
popq %rbx
movq %rbp, %rsp
cfi_def_cfa_register (%rsp)
popq %rbp
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set (-8)
cfi_restore (%rbp)
ret
.endm
/* AVX512 ISA version as wrapper to AVX2 ISA version. */
.macro WRAPPER_IMPL_AVX512 callee
pushq %rbp
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set (8)
cfi_rel_offset (%rbp, 0)
movq %rsp, %rbp
cfi_def_cfa_register (%rbp)
andq $-64, %rsp
subq $64, %rsp
vmovups %zmm0, (%rsp)
call HIDDEN_JUMPTARGET(\callee)
vmovupd %ymm0, (%rsp)
vmovupd 32(%rsp), %ymm0
call HIDDEN_JUMPTARGET(\callee)
/* combine ymm0 (return of second call) with result of first
call (saved on stack). */
vmovaps (%rsp), %ymm1
vinserti64x4 $0x1, %ymm0, %zmm1, %zmm0
movq %rbp, %rsp
cfi_def_cfa_register (%rsp)
popq %rbp
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set (-8)
cfi_restore (%rbp)
ret
.endm
/* 2 argument AVX512 ISA version as wrapper to AVX2 ISA version. */
.macro WRAPPER_IMPL_AVX512_ff callee
pushq %rbp
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set (8)
cfi_rel_offset (%rbp, 0)
movq %rsp, %rbp
cfi_def_cfa_register (%rbp)
andq $-64, %rsp
addq $-128, %rsp
vmovups %zmm0, (%rsp)
vmovups %zmm1, 64(%rsp)
/* ymm0 and ymm1 are already set. */
call HIDDEN_JUMPTARGET(\callee)
vmovups 96(%rsp), %ymm1
vmovaps %ymm0, (%rsp)
vmovups 32(%rsp), %ymm0
call HIDDEN_JUMPTARGET(\callee)
/* combine ymm0 (return of second call) with result of first
call (saved on stack). */
vmovaps (%rsp), %ymm1
vinserti64x4 $0x1, %ymm0, %zmm1, %zmm0
movq %rbp, %rsp
cfi_def_cfa_register (%rsp)
popq %rbp
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set (-8)
cfi_restore (%rbp)
ret
.endm
/* 3 argument AVX512 ISA version as wrapper to AVX2 ISA version. */
.macro WRAPPER_IMPL_AVX512_fFF callee
pushq %rbp
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set (8)
cfi_rel_offset (%rbp, 0)
movq %rsp, %rbp
cfi_def_cfa_register (%rbp)
andq $-64, %rsp
subq $64, %rsp
vmovaps %zmm0, (%rsp)
pushq %rbx
pushq %r14
movq %rdi, %rbx
movq %rsi, %r14
/* ymm0 is already set. */
call HIDDEN_JUMPTARGET(\callee)
vmovaps 48(%rsp), %ymm0
leaq 32(%rbx), %rdi
leaq 32(%r14), %rsi
call HIDDEN_JUMPTARGET(\callee)
popq %r14
popq %rbx
movq %rbp, %rsp
cfi_def_cfa_register (%rsp)
popq %rbp
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set (-8)
cfi_restore (%rbp)
ret
.endm
